Transaction f6152474968dc52c8bfe6218181c6637ee315747799e46116eae79b1069797ae

1 Input
2 Outputs
  • f6152474968dc52c8bfe6218181c6637ee315747799e46116eae79b1069797ae:0
  • value  25698
    address  1Fu7ScHXt4snypqUmmJdrWnTdUEuEvyHKA
  • f6152474968dc52c8bfe6218181c6637ee315747799e46116eae79b1069797ae:1
  • value  594520
    address  3PH6XAz3MRUsNjWe7FQeknU27SR1CVjNap